Wars of Kappel

The wars of Kappel (Kappelerkriege) were two armed conflicts fought near Kappel am Albis between the Protestant and the Roman Catholic cantons of the Old Swiss Confederacy during the reformation in Switzerland.

  • First War of Kappel (1529)
  • Second War of Kappel (1531)
